The Rationale Behind the Ban

Flavored e-cigarettes have been under scrutiny due to their appeal to younger audiences. The FDA has emphasized that flavors such as fruit, candy, and mint are particularly enticing to teens, increasing the risk of nicotine addiction. By implementing this ban, the FDA hopes to make e-cigarettes less appealing to underage users, thus addressing public health concerns.

Potential Consequences for Consumers

While the ban aims to protect young users, it raises questions about the impact on adult consumers who rely on flavored e-cigarettes as a smoking cessation tool. Some argue that the restriction could hinder smokers’ efforts to quit traditional cigarettes, potentially driving them back to tobacco use. It’s essential for these consumers to explore other cessation aids and support systems during this transition period.
